“We've done a pretty good job at being able to acquire sequence information. That's, you know, some of the fastest advances in technology in the history of mankind. I'm told it's actually only beat by one other technology, which is the sort of the clarity of glass improved at a faster rate over a period of time.”

Interpreting novel genetic variants costs 100x to 1000x more than sequencing
“And interpreting each one of those under the current clinical practices costs 50 to a hundred dollars. So we're talking about a hundred to thousand-fold increase in the cost of interpretation relative to the cost of data acquisition.”

Only 0.6% of disease-associated gene mutations have clinical interpretations
“If we look across all of the disease-associated genes that we know today, we only have clinical interpretations for roughly . Six percent of the possible mutations in them.”
